Prophet Nuh (Noah, peace be upon him) was one of the earliest messengers sent by Allah to guide humanity. His mission was to call his people to worship only Allah, abandon idol worship, and live a life of righteousness. For nearly 950 years, Prophet Nuh preached patience, obedience, and faith, urging his people to repent and seek forgiveness, but the majority of them rejected his message and continued in disbelief.

Despite the rejection, Prophet Nuh remained steadfast and dedicated to his mission. He tirelessly invited people to the truth—sometimes in public, sometimes in private—using wisdom, compassion, and persistence. However, only a small group of followers accepted his call, while the rest mocked him, ignored his warnings, and clung to their idols. His struggle highlights the challenges faced by prophets in guiding their communities.
When his people continuously denied the message, Allah commanded Prophet Nuh to build an ark.
